By Time — Man Is in Loss — Four Conditions for Salvation in Three Verses

إِلَّا ٱلَّذِينَ ءَامَنُواْ وَعَمِلُواْ ٱلصَّٰلِحَٰتِ وَتَوَاصَوۡاْ بِٱلۡحَقِّ
— العصر الآية 3
Verse: "By time — man is in loss — except those who believe, do righteous deeds, enjoin truth upon each other, and enjoin patience upon each other." (103:1-3) — Al-Shafi'i said: "If people reflected on this surah alone it would suffice them." Why sufficiency: the assumption of loss for all humanity — then four conditions for salvation: faith (heart), righteous deeds (limbs), enjoining truth (social impact), enjoining patience (continuity and steadfastness). "Enjoin" not "do" — the group is a condition: individual salvation does not suffice without social mutual exhortation. Lesson: the believing, righteous individual is not self-sufficient — they must participate in society with truth and patience.
Source: Ibn Kathir (8/461); Al-Sadi
